Autoplay
Autocomplete
Previous Lesson
Complete and Continue
IOS 14 & Swift 5 - The Complete iOS App Development Course
Introduction
Introduction to Course (1:40)
XCODE Overview and Simulator
Create First Project (9:25)
Swift Holding Data (10:34)
Swift Data Types (6:48)
Basic Swift Rules (11:08)
quiz
Create UI
How to Create UI? (13:24)
Connect UI and Code (14:44)
Adding Constraints to Design (10:48)
Swift Conditional Statements (11:53)
First App Final (9:34)
quiz
Reach Data from UI
SWIFT How to make math operations (12:19)
SWIFT Floats vs Doubles (7:41)
Different UI Elements (19:42)
Reach data from UI (11:40)
UI Actions (8:03)
SWIFT Logic and booleans (5:02)
quiz
Listing Data on IOS
App Introduction (1:21)
SWIFT Listing data structure Arrays (15:05)
Listing Data on IOS (13:09)
How to list data on TableView (9:44)
Create TableView data (8:43)
quiz
Routing on IOS
Route to another screen (15:31)
Data transfer between screens (13:25)
Country Detail Screen (3:51)
SWIFT for in Loop (6:55)
quiz
Important Swift Concepts
Swift Functions (12:11)
Swift Take Data from a function (10:09)
Swift Classes (10:56)
Swift Class Methods (8:43)
Swift Build Class hierarchy (11:06)
quiz
App refactor with Classes
Refactor CountryList (14:48)
Swift Optionals (10:47)
Reorganize CountryList App (13:33)
Blog App
App Preview (3:11)
Create and Design the App (17:39)
Connect Code and Visual Side (11:12)
Show Blog Entries in TableView (11:37)
How to Save Data
How to save Data (13:23)
How to reach data from CoreData (17:57)
Blog Entry Detail (13:53)
Automatic Function Calls (11:45)
Design Issues (11:42)
Design List Items (14:48)
Blog App Final (17:26)
Jason and API
What are JSON and API? (8:10)
Building Data Structure (6:40)
Guard Else and Do Catch Statements (12:45)
Decoder, Codable and Coding Keys (7:54)
quiz
MVVM
MVVM (7:03)
Code Refactoring (7:13)
Creating the ViewModel (4:31)
Booklist
Book List UI Design (8:40)
Creating TableViewCell (10:32)
ViewController and Final (4:58)
Deploy to App Store
How to Create an Apple Developer Account (8:35)
Provisioning Profile (10:33)
How to Setup Icons for iOS Apps (6:06)
Uploading App to App Store (6:35)
Metadata and Submitting App For Review (9:09)
Metadata and Submitting App For Review
Lesson content locked
If you're already enrolled,
you'll need to login
.
Enroll in Course to Unlock